Admission rate

Emmaus Bible College admitted 59.8% of applicants university-wide (116 of 194).

Of 116 admitted students, 74 enrolled (63.8% yield).

Academics and campus

Largest degree fields: Computer & information sciences (5%), Business & marketing (4%), Psychology (3%).

Student–faculty ratio: 10:1 · 78% of class sections have under 20 students.
